About the project:
A platform for selling cars on the German market. The platform has about 1 million users in a month.
Microservice architecture, high load project.
Tech Stack: TS, MongoDB, Redis, Elastic, GCloud Platform, Kubernetes.
We are looking for a Node.js Developer to join the Lviv team on a full-time basis.
What will make you successful:
— 4+ years of experience with Node.js;
— Strong knowledge of Node.js frameworks (Express, Nest.Js);
— Successful application and database design architecture experience;
— Understanding OOP, SOLID, YAGNI, KISS, DRY, microservices architecture, and event-driven architecture;
— Good knowledge of SQL and NoSQL-based databases;
— Strong analytical skills, understanding of popular design patterns;
— Experience in using TypeScript;
What we offer:
— Long-term cooperation with an opportunity for professional and personal development;
— Paid courses for your career growth;
— Salary paid in USD, flexible banking choice;
— 18 vacation days and 21 sick leaves which are fully covered;
— Extra bonuses for wedding/ childbirth;
— Free English classes during working time;
— Close cooperation with a customer;
— Dynamic environment with a low level of bureaucracy;
— Online / offline events; office in Lviv.